Rajupeta
Rajupeta is a village located in Bobbili mandal of Vizianagaram district in Andhra Pradesh, India. It is situated 6km away from sub-district headquarter Bobbili (tehsildar office) and 68km away from district headquarter Vizianagaram. As per 2009 stats, Gopalarayudupeta is the gram panchayat of Rajupeta village.

About Rajupeta
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Rajupeta is 582315. The village spans a total geographical area of 129 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 535558. Bobbili is nearest town to Rajupeta village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 6km away.

Population of Rajupeta
Below is a concise population overview of Rajupeta as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 564 | 276 | 288 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 51 | 22 | 29 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 64 | 27 | 37 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 5 | 1 | 4 |
Literate Population | 343 | 204 | 139 |
Illiterate Population | 221 | 72 | 149 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Rajupeta village:
- The total population of Rajupeta village is around 564, including approximately 276 males and 288 females, with a sex ratio of 1043 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 51 children aged 0–6 years in Rajupeta village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Rajupeta village has 64 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 5 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Rajupeta village is about 60.82%, with male literacy at 73.91% and female literacy at 48.26%.
- There are around 149 households in Rajupeta village.
Connectivity of Rajupeta
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Rajupeta. As per the 2011 stats, Rajupeta had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
